Under what circumstances did Alauddin ascend the throne of Delhi?

उत्तर
Alauddin captured the throne of Delhi by killing his uncle Jalaluddin Khilji. As the situation at that time was very bad because Jalaluddin was a very mild and pious person, which led to lawlessness and revolts. Alauddin took advantage of the situation and ascended the throne.
